Here are some of the major advantages of using the former. Credit unions are not-for-profits that are actually owned by their members. Because of this, they pass on savings and deals to their membership rather than trying to make a buck. Also, these establishments pool together their buying power to offer low interest rate loans and other perks. Automobile loans, for example, have been known to be two percent lower than at traditional banks because of this buying power. Another great thing about these unique institutions is that they actually care about their members' financial well-being. Because of this, they provide regular free workshops dealing with money management, saving, investing, budgeting, and home buying. They even offer free personal financial counseling to keep their members on track. These institutions are known to look out for the little guy. An example of this is that they actually provide checking accounts to people who have been turned down by traditional banks. The only caveat is that the person or couple seeking out the account is expected to attend a six hour seminar on money management and budgeting.
